I have a problem with this helemt and was trying to see what you guys thought....
After a few e-mails to the seller, I have found out that the date dial says 98, there is no COA, and the seller obtained the item from a "memorabilia trade, with a former equipment manager", (We've never heard that before...)
The first problem with the helmet is the numbering on the back of the helmet, from what I have found on getty the style and placement, as well as color of the number is wrong. The second problem is that there is no "purchased from the Cleveland Indians" stamp on the inside and most if not all the helmets that I have seen in the modern era have this stamp.
Other then that the helmet does have all the other characteristics that I am familiar with as far as game used helmets...

Gannon, you pretty much hit the nail on the head....never seen the blue number on the helmet before, no stamp, no COA and also the wrong size. I have some Lofton hats and a helmet - all size 7.

Here are a couple getty pics of the batting helmets from that time period with Justice from 1998 and Alomar from 1999. As you can see they transitioned from white numbers to red between the two years.
